What to Consider About Assisted Living in Tomball

The 1790 streets in Tomball cover a total of 72 miles, which is the exact distance from this suburb of 11,353 people to and from Houston on a single round trip. This area has 64 assisted living communities, which are overseen at the state level by the Texas Department of Health and Human Services. The department works to ensure aging citizens enjoy as much independence and privacy in assisted living as their health allows. Staff at facilities in Tomball, and elsewhere in Texas, provide 24-hour emergency response, help to take some medications and assistance with activities of daily living (ADLs), such as dressing, meal prep and personal care.

Benefits and Drawbacks of Assisted Living in Tomball

  • Weather in Tomball varies between cool, dry winters when seniors with COPD or other respiratory issues may want to stay indoors, and warm, humid summers when temperatures average 93 degrees Fahrenheit. Tomball gets about 45 inches of rain in an average year.

  • Tomball's cost of living is not bad for seniors who pay their own expenses. Groceries here cost an average of 84 percent what they do nationwide, while the cost of health care services averages 97 percent the national median.

  • Texas residents pay no income tax on their earnings, and that includes seniors living on SSI, Social Security and other forms of retirement income. Sales tax of between 6.25 and 8.25 percent does apply to most purchases, however, and there's a 20 cent gas tax on every gallon sold. 

  • Crime rates in Tomball are almost exactly in step with national averages. One exception is in violent crime, such as crimes against seniors, where Tomball is somewhat lower than average nationwide.

  • Harris County Transit operates the RIDES network in and around the Tomball area. This service is aimed at aging citizens who need scheduled transportation from their homes or assisted living communities for shopping, medical office visits and the occasional day trip. Riders can go as far as northwest Houston, where METROrail takes over with a modern system of trains.

  • The Tomball area is home to world-class medical facilities, including Tomball Regional Medical Center, in the event of medical emergencies or illness.

Paying for Assisted Living in Tomball

Assisted Living costs in Tomball start around $3,925 per month on average, while the nationwide average cost of assisted living is $4,000 per month, according to the latest figures from Genworth’s Cost of Care Survey.

It’s important to note that assisted living rates in Tomball and the surrounding suburbs can vary widely based on factors such as location, the level of care needed, apartment size and the types of amenities offered at each community.

Financial Assistance for Assisted Living in Tomball

Low- and no-income seniors who qualify for Medicaid with no share of cost might be able to get help paying for assisted living through the state waiver program, which is called STAR+PLUS. Aging citizens on this plan are essentially waiving placement in a nursing home in exchange for help with their residential care costs.
